Similarly Is Facebook allowed in China now? Yes, Facebook is blocked in China. It was first blocked back in 2009 in order to allow the Chinese government to control how its citizens use western social media. Even in 2022, the government continues to crack down on access to « western » media and platforms, continuing to make it harder and harder.

Is Instagram allowed in China?

Yes, Instagram is banned in China. Alongside many of the biggest social media networks and social apps like Facebook, WhatsApp, Reddit, Youtube, Twitch, Tumblr, Imgur, Quora, and many many others, Instagram is also blocked by the Chinese Internet censorship policy.

Is Twitter banned in China?

Twitter is officially blocked in China; however, many Chinese people circumvent the block to use it. Even major Chinese companies and national medias, such as Huawei and CCTV, use Twitter through a government approved VPN.

Is Amazon banned in China?

Amazon continues to offer limited services in China, like Amazon Prime, but without the on-demand video benefits. Customers can still enter the webpage amazon.cn, but can only access products imported from Amazon sites located overseas. This includes the US, UK, Germany or Japan.

Is YouTube banned in Pakistan?

Social media and platform blocking. YouTube was blocked in Pakistan following a decision taken by the Pakistan Telecommunication Authority on 22 February 2008 because of the number of « non-Islamic objectionable videos. » One report specifically named Fitna, a controversial Dutch film, as the basis for the block.

Does China have its own Internet?

The Internet is available all over China, but not all of the Internet is available. Sites like Google’s and social media like Facebook are censored and blocked, needing technology like VPNs for access. Wi-Fi connections are quite common, and you can connect to them often in the same way as in the West.

Who made TikTok?

Zhang Yiming (Chinese: 张一鸣; born April 1, 1983 in Longyan, Fujian) is a Chinese internet entrepreneur. He founded ByteDance in 2012 and developed the news aggregator Toutiao and the video sharing platform TikTok (Douyin/抖音), formerly known as Musical.ly.
